About Kirwari

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Kirwari village is 072204. Kirwari village is located in Kotkasim tehsil of Alwar district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 36km away from sub-district headquarter Kotkasim (tehsildar office) and 34km away from district headquarter Alwar. As per 2009 stats, Jatiyana is the gram panchayat of Kirwari village.

The total geographical area of village is 196 hectares. Kirwari has a total population of 1,648 peoples, out of which male population is 849 while female population is 799.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 941 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of kirwari village is 52.18% out of which 67.02% males and 36.42% females are literate. There are about 226 houses in kirwari village. Pincode of kirwari village locality is 301403.

When it comes to administration, Kirwari village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Kirwari village comes under Kishangarh bas Vidhan Sabha constituency & Alwar Lok Sabha constituency. Alwar is nearest town to kirwari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 34km away.

Population of Kirwari

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,648 849 799
Literate Population 860 569 291
Illiterate Population 788 280 508
